13. Adjust both torque stops so that you have a clearance of
.010"-.030" (.25-.75mm).
Torque Stop Clearance: .010"-.030" (.25-.75mm)
14. Connect the Regulator Rectifier (12) and Stator (13)
connections.
15. Connect the thermostat cooling hose and secure it with the
clamp (14).
16. Connect the cooling hose going to the water pump (front
of engine) to the water bottle and secure it with the clamp.
17. Connect the impulse line from the fuel pump to the
crankcase.
18. Route the over fill hose (15) and secure it with a cable tie.

19. Connect the water temp sensor (16) and secure it to the
thermostat hose with a cable tie.

20. Connect the exhaust valve vent lines (18).

21. Install the oil supply lines to each of the carburetors.
22. Install the carburetors onto the carburetor boots and tighten
the clamps.
23. Connect the TPS sensor to the carburetors.
24. Install the two, Nyloc nuts and two T40 Torx bolts to the
front (19) and the two T40 to the rear (20) of the LH chassis
brace and install the brace.
NOTE: Install the long bolts and the spacer on the
front portion of the bar before inserting it into the
mounting area.

25. Replace the nosepan plugs.
26. Install the air box.
27. Install the driven clutch. See "Drive Clutch Installation" on
page 6.20.
